Shiro核心概念
image.png

Subject:正如我们教程中提到的,Subject是程序安全视角的user。然而user通常指人类,但Subject可以是人,也可以指第三方的服务,守护进程账户,定时任务,或者其他类似的东西-基本上可以是和软件交互的任何事物。

Subject 的实例都绑定在SecurityManager上。当你和subject交互时,SecurityManager把交互转化为subject领域的交互。

SecurityManager:SecurityManager是Shiro架构的核心,他扮演着伞对象的角色(持有各组件引用,协调调用),来协调它内部的安全组件,他们一块来形成对象视图。然而,一旦程序中的SecurityManager和他内部对象已经配置好,通常上就不用再管他,程序的开发人员几乎大部分时间都会花在Subject API上。

我们接下来会深入讨论SeccurityManager。当你和Subject交互时,所做的任何Subject的安全操作,实际上是SecurityManager在幕后辛苦劳作。你要意识到这一点很重要。这些都在上面的基础流程图中有所反映。

Realms:Realms在Shiro和你的程序安全数据之间,扮演着桥梁或者连接器的角色。当和安全相关数据有交互时,比如用户登录校验和鉴权,Shiro通过程序中配置的一个或者多个Realm来查询。

在此场景中,Realm是安全领域的DAO:它封装了数据源连接的细节,使得相关数据对于shiro可用。当你配置Shiro,你必须指定至少一个realm用来登录和授权。SecurityManager可能会配置多个Realm,但是至少有一个。

Shrio提供了开箱即用的Realm来链接各种安全数据源,例如LDAP,关系型数据库(JDBC),文本配置如INI或者properties文件,等等。如果默认的Realm不能满足你的需求,你可以插入你自己的Realm实现来表述客制化的数据源。

就像其他内部的组件,Shiro的SecurityManager管理如何使用Realm来获取Subject实例相关的安全和身份信息。

二、 快速开始

  1. 导入依赖
<!-- https://mvnrepository.com/artifact/org.apache.shiro/shiro-core -->
		<dependency>
			<groupId>org.apache.shiro</groupId>
			<artifactId>shiro-core</artifactId>
			<version>1.4.2</version>
		</dependency>

		<!-- configure logging -->
		<dependency>
			<groupId>org.slf4j</groupId>
			<artifactId>jcl-over-slf4j</artifactId>
			<version>1.7.21</version>
			<scope>runtime</scope>
		</dependency>
		<dependency>
			<groupId>org.slf4j</groupId>
			<artifactId>slf4j-log4j12</artifactId>
			<version>1.7.21</version>
			<scope>runtime</scope>
		</dependency>
		<dependency>
			<groupId>log4j</groupId>
			<artifactId>log4j</artifactId>
			<scope>runtime</scope>
			<version>1.2.17</version>
		</dependency>
  1. 配置log4j.properties
log4j.rootLogger=INFO, stdout

log4j.appender.stdout=org.apache.log4j.ConsoleAppender
log4j.appender.stdout.layout=org.apache.log4j.PatternLayout
log4j.appender.stdout.layout.ConversionPattern=%d %p [%c] - %m %n

# General Apache libraries
log4j.logger.org.apache=WARN

# Spring
log4j.logger.org.springframework=WARN

# Default Shiro logging
log4j.logger.org.apache.shiro=INFO

# Disable verbose logging
log4j.logger.org.apache.shiro.util.ThreadContext=WARN
log4j.logger.org.apache.shiro.cache.ehcache.EhCache=WARN
  1. 配置shiro.ini
[users]
# user 'root' with password 'secret' and the 'admin' role
root = secret, admin
# user 'guest' with the password 'guest' and the 'guest' role
guest = guest, guest
# user 'presidentskroob' with password '12345' ("That's the same combination on
# my luggage!!!" ;)), and role 'president'
presidentskroob = 12345, president
# user 'darkhelmet' with password 'ludicrousspeed' and roles 'darklord' and 'schwartz'
darkhelmet = ludicrousspeed, darklord, schwartz
# user 'lonestarr' with password 'vespa' and roles 'goodguy' and 'schwartz'
lonestarr = vespa, goodguy, schwartz

# -----------------------------------------------------------------------------
# Roles with assigned permissions
#
# Each line conforms to the format defined in the
# org.apache.shiro.realm.text.TextConfigurationRealm#setRoleDefinitions JavaDoc
# -----------------------------------------------------------------------------
[roles]
# 'admin' role has all permissions, indicated by the wildcard '*'
admin = *
# The 'schwartz' role can do anything (*) with any lightsaber:
schwartz = lightsaber:*
# The 'goodguy' role is allowed to 'drive' (action) the winnebago (type) with
# license plate 'eagle5' (instance specific id)
goodguy = winnebago:drive:eagle5
  1. 创建QuickStart类
public class QuickStart {

    private static final transient Logger log = LoggerFactory.getLogger(QuickStart.class);


    public static void main(String[] args) {

        // The easiest way to create a Shiro SecurityManager with configured
        // realms, users, roles and permissions is to use the simple INI config.
        // We'll do that by using a factory that can ingest a .ini file and
        // return a SecurityManager instance:

        // Use the shiro.ini file at the root of the classpath
        // (file: and url: prefixes load from files and urls respectively):
        Factory<SecurityManager> factory = new IniSecurityManagerFactory("classpath:shiro.ini");
        SecurityManager securityManager = factory.getInstance();

        // for this simple example quickstart, make the SecurityManager
        // accessible as a JVM singleton.  Most applications wouldn't do this
        // and instead rely on their container configuration or web.xml for
        // webapps.  That is outside the scope of this simple quickstart, so
        // we'll just do the bare minimum so you can continue to get a feel
        // for things.
        SecurityUtils.setSecurityManager(securityManager);

        // Now that a simple Shiro environment is set up, let's see what you can do:

        // get the currently executing user:
        Subject currentUser = SecurityUtils.getSubject();

        // Do some stuff with a Session (no need for a web or EJB container!!!)
        Session session = currentUser.getSession();
        session.setAttribute("someKey", "aValue");
        String value = (String) session.getAttribute("someKey");
        if (value.equals("aValue")) {
            log.info("Retrieved the correct value! [" + value + "]");
        }

        // let's login the current user so we can check against roles and permissions:
        if (!currentUser.isAuthenticated()) {
            UsernamePasswordToken token = new UsernamePasswordToken("lonestarr", "vespa");
            token.setRememberMe(true);
            try {
                currentUser.login(token);
            } catch (UnknownAccountException uae) {
                log.info("There is no user with username of " + token.getPrincipal());
            } catch (IncorrectCredentialsException ice) {
                log.info("Password for account " + token.getPrincipal() + " was incorrect!");
            } catch (LockedAccountException lae) {
                log.info("The account for username " + token.getPrincipal() + " is locked.  " +
                        "Please contact your administrator to unlock it.");
            }
            // ... catch more exceptions here (maybe custom ones specific to your application?
            catch (AuthenticationException ae) {
                //unexpected condition?  error?
            }
        }

        //say who they are:
        //print their identifying principal (in this case, a username):
        log.info("User [" + currentUser.getPrincipal() + "] logged in successfully.");

        //test a role:
        if (currentUser.hasRole("schwartz")) {
            log.info("May the Schwartz be with you!");
        } else {
            log.info("Hello, mere mortal.");
        }

        //test a typed permission (not instance-level)
        if (currentUser.isPermitted("lightsaber:wield")) {
            log.info("You may use a lightsaber ring.  Use it wisely.");
        } else {
            log.info("Sorry, lightsaber rings are for schwartz masters only.");
        }

        //a (very powerful) Instance Level permission:
        if (currentUser.isPermitted("winnebago:drive:eagle5")) {
            log.info("You are permitted to 'drive' the winnebago with license plate (id) 'eagle5'.  " +
                    "Here are the keys - have fun!");
        } else {
            log.info("Sorry, you aren't allowed to drive the 'eagle5' winnebago!");
        }

        //all done - log out!
        currentUser.logout();

        System.exit(0);
    }
}

  1. shiro配置
public class UserRealm extends AuthorizingRealm {

    @Autowired
    UserService userService;

    /** 授权
     *
     * @param principalCollection
     * @return
     */
    @Override
    protected AuthorizationInfo doGetAuthorizationInfo(PrincipalCollection principalCollection) {
        System.out.println("执行了授权");

        // 授权
        SimpleAuthorizationInfo info = new SimpleAuthorizationInfo();
//        info.addStringPermission("user:add");

        // 拿到当前登录的这个对象
        Subject subject = SecurityUtils.getSubject();
        User principal = (User)subject.getPrincipal(); // 获取user对象
        info.addStringPermission(principal.getPerms()); // 设置当前用户的权限
        return info;
    }

    /**
     *  认证
     * @param authenticationToken
     * @return
     * @throws AuthenticationException
     */
    @Override
    protected AuthenticationInfo doGetAuthenticationInfo(AuthenticationToken authenticationToken) throws AuthenticationException {
        System.out.println("执行了认证");

        //连接真实的数据库

        UsernamePasswordToken token = (UsernamePasswordToken) authenticationToken;

        User user = userService.queryUserByName(token.getUsername());
        if (user == null){
            // 说明没有这个用户
            return null;
        }

        Subject current = SecurityUtils.getSubject();
        Session session = current.getSession();
        session.setAttribute("loginUser", user);

        //密码认证
        return new SimpleAuthenticationInfo(user, user.getPassword(), "");
    }
}


@Configuration
public class ShiroConfig {

    //ShiroFilterFactoryBean
    @Bean
    public ShiroFilterFactoryBean shiroFilterFactoryBean(@Qualifier("defaultWebSecurityManager") DefaultSecurityManager securityManager){
        ShiroFilterFactoryBean bean = new ShiroFilterFactoryBean();
        // 设置安全管理器
        bean.setSecurityManager(securityManager);

        // 添加shiro的内置过滤器
        /*
         * anon: 无需认证就可以访问
         * authc: 需要认证了才能访问
         * user: 必须拥有记住我才能用
         * perms: 拥有某个资源的权限才能访问
         * role: 拥有某个角色权限才能访问
         */
        Map<String, String> map = new HashMap<>();
        // 授权
        map.put("/user/add", "perms[user:add]");
        map.put("/user/update", "perms[user:update]");



        bean.setFilterChainDefinitionMap(map);

        // 设置登录的请求
        bean.setLoginUrl("/toLogin");

        //设置未授权请求
        bean.setUnauthorizedUrl("/noauth");

        return bean;
    }

    //DefaultWebSecurityManager
    @Bean
    public DefaultWebSecurityManager defaultWebSecurityManager(@Qualifier("userRealm") UserRealm userRealm){
        DefaultWebSecurityManager defaultWebSecurityManager = new DefaultWebSecurityManager();
        //关联userRealm
        defaultWebSecurityManager.setRealm(userRealm);
        return defaultWebSecurityManager;
    }

    //创建 realm对象 需要自定义类
    @Bean
    public UserRealm userRealm(){
        return new UserRealm();
    }

    // 整合ShiroDialect: 用来整合Shiro和thymeleaf
    @Bean
    public ShiroDialect shiroDialect(){
        ShiroDialect shiroDialect = new ShiroDialect();
        return shiroDialect;
    }
}
